The Climate Impacts Group is growing our team! We’re currently hiring for
the following positions to help us enact our new strategic plan
<https://cig.uw.edu/about/our-strategic-plan-2024-2029/> and increase
climate resilience in our region. Positions are hybrid eligible, with
in-person requirements in Seattle, Wash., unless otherwise stated.

Tribal Climate Adaptation Specialist, Northwest Climate Resilience
Collaborative

- Applications must be received by Nov. 24, 2024
- Demonstrated experience using climate information to inform climate
adaptation and resilience efforts, and familiarity with best practices
around Tribal outreach and engagement
- Experience managing grant program and supporting partners throughout
the grant lifecycle
- Passionate about our organizational mission and co-production model
- $6158 – $7,037 per month salary range

Learn more and apply
<https://cig.uw.edu/about/cig-careers/tribal-climate-adaptation-specialist-northwest-climate-resilience-collaborative/>
Research Scientist (RS2) – Water & Climate

- Applications must be received by Nov. 22, 2024
- Early-career position with some experience in water resources
management and training in applied social or natural sciences, engineering,
planning, or a related field
- Familiarity with topics such as climate resilience, water management,
and adaptation strategies
- Passionate about our organizational mission and co-production model
- $4,649 – $7,057 per month salary range
